Not to add more to your list, but one of my favorite things to do in St Remy isn’t even technically in St Remy (you have to drive a little out of town). Have you looked into the Van Gogh museum? It’s the still in operation asylum he was committed in and painted a lot of his famous work at. It’s really quite an interesting shop and I love how they have his famous pieces around the space, showing the view he had when painting.

What day will this be? The antique market in Villeneuve Les Avignon on Saturday’s is really great. There is also a lot of wonderful dealers with warehouses you could visit around the region.
